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4092248 240947 8845 10304 13150
0126 0858124648 2300
0126 0858124648 2300
3225212116 546 3629020447 59 03505
All about undefined
Interested in learning more?
0126 0858124648 2300
3225212116 546 3629020447 59 03505
See more
5590627994 44863308
392 9946 4820881754
See more
76459683 3271607402
4877743 6148481 339649
See more